Spiritual accountability and guidance

Charles Potjer·2024-09-01
Read Full Text on Original Source

Have you ever had a friend who seemed to drift away spiritually? Have you ever felt yourself drifting away spiritually? Do your conversa- tions with fellow churchgoers ever go deeper than the same old surface- level topics? Does it seem that a shared hobby or interest makes up the foundation of most friendships? As followers of Christ we are told in James 5:16 to “confess your faults one to another, and pray one for another, that ye may be healed.” God is calling us to spiritually guide one...
